Relationship between gut microbiome and bone deficits in primary hyperparathyroidism: A proof-of-concept pilot study

Meric Coskun,
Afruz Babayeva,
Tugba Barlas
et al.

Abstract: Parathyroid hormone (PTH) interacts with components of the gut microbiota to exert its bone-regulating effects. This study aimed to investigate the gut microbial composition in patients with primary hyperparathyroidism (PHPT). Nine patients with PHPT and nine age-sex and body mass index-matched healthy controls were included. Gut microbial composition was assessed using 16S rRNA gene amplicon sequencing in both groups at baseline and one month after parathyroidectomy in the PHPT group. Data were imported into … Show more
